How To Fix WGDS_CC_2012058 - Enter a number of trade items greater than 0


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WGDS_CC_2012 - Messages for customer connect enhancement of GDS in 2012

  • Message number: 058

  • Message text: Enter a number of trade items greater than 0

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message WGDS_CC_2012058 - Enter a number of trade items greater than 0 ?

    Certainly! Here's a detailed explanation for the SAP error message:


    SAP Error Message:

    WGDS_CC_2012058: Enter a number of trade items greater than 0


    Cause:

    This error occurs when you are trying to process or save a document (such as a delivery, shipment, or sales order) in SAP where the quantity of trade items (e.g., packages, cartons, pallets) is either zero or not entered at all. The system requires that the number of trade items must be a positive number greater than zero to proceed.

    Trade items typically refer to packaging units or handling units that are part of the logistics process. The system validation ensures that the physical quantity of items being handled is correctly recorded.


    When does it occur?

    • During delivery creation or confirmation.
    • When handling unit management is active and the system expects trade item quantities.
    • In processes involving packing or shipment where trade item quantities are mandatory.
    • When using SAP EWM (Extended Warehouse Management) or SAP TM (Transportation Management) integrated with SAP ERP.

    Solution:

    1. Enter a valid number of trade items:
      Make sure to input a quantity greater than zero in the relevant field for trade items or packaging units.

    2. Check the packaging data:
      Verify that the packaging specifications or handling unit data are correctly maintained in the system. If packaging data is missing or incorrect, update it accordingly.

    3. Review configuration settings:

      • Check if the system requires trade item quantities for the document type you are processing.
      • In case of custom validations or user exits, verify if any custom logic is enforcing this check.
    4. Handling Unit Management:
      If handling units are used, ensure that the handling units are properly created and assigned with correct quantities.

    5. Data consistency:
      Ensure that the quantity of trade items aligns with the quantity of goods being processed.


    Related Information:

    • Transaction codes: VL01N (Create Delivery), VL02N (Change Delivery), VL10, /SCWM/PRDO (EWM Delivery), /SCMTMS/ (Transportation Management)
    • Tables:
      • LIKP (Delivery Header)
      • LIPS (Delivery Item)
      • VEKP (Handling Unit Header)
      • VEPO (Handling Unit Item)
    • SAP Notes: Search for notes related to WGDS_CC_2012058 or packaging/trade item quantity validations.
    • Configuration paths:
      • Logistics Execution ? Shipping ? Basic Shipping Functions ? Packaging
      • Warehouse Management ? Handling Unit Management

    Summary:

    The error WGDS_CC_2012058 is a validation message requiring that the number of trade items (packaging units) entered must be greater than zero. To resolve it, ensure that the trade item quantity is correctly entered and consistent with the goods quantity, and verify packaging and handling unit data.
